Tracking Point Accumulation Systems in Live Competitions

Not all live dealer tournaments calculate standings using the same mathematical model. Understanding how a specific leaderboard tallies points dictates your optimal session length and wagering style.

Operators generally utilize three primary point scoring formulas for table competitions. Analyzing these mechanics helps you determine whether an event favors casual strategists or deep-pocketed high rollers.

  • Wager Volume Scoring: Awards points based strictly on total dollar turnover, giving high rollers a distinct structural advantage.

  • Win Streak Tracking: Grants points for consecutive winning hands, allowing casual players with smaller bankrolls to compete fairly.

  • Multiplier-Based Points: Calculates points as a ratio of single-hand net wins relative to initial bet size, rewarding high multiplier outcomes.

  • Net Profit Leaderboards: Ranks players according to total net winnings generated across a fixed number of qualifying hands.

Evaluating point generation rules before opting in prevents wasted playing time. For example, competing in a pure wager volume race with a modest bankroll is mathematically unviable.

Analysing Prize Distribution Models and Reward Types

Understanding how an operator structures its tournament prize pool is critical for evaluating net expected value. A massive headline prize pool does not always guarantee a lucrative payout for mid-tier leaderboard finishers.

Prize distribution models dictate how money is split across top standings. You must analyze whether an event features a top-heavy framework or a broad, tiered distribution.

Top-Heavy Model: Top 3 Finisher Focus -> High Volatility -> Maximum Risk Exposure
Tiered Model: Top 50 Finisher Distribution -> Lower Volatility -> Balanced Profit Opportunity

Top-heavy prize pools allocate 70% or more of total funds to the top three positions. While winning first place yields a massive payout, failing to reach the absolute top leaves you with minimal compensation.

In contrast, tiered distribution models distribute funds evenly across twenty to fifty leaderboard spots. This setup reduces financial variance, allowing consistent players to secure guaranteed profits far more easily.

Additionally, pay close attention to the format of the awarded prizes. Premier operators distribute tournament rewards as raw cash with zero wagering requirements attached.

Avoid competitions that pay top prizes in restricted bonus credits subject to heavy rollover multipliers. Securing wager-free prize money ensures that your tournament winnings remain liquid for immediate withdrawal.

Balancing Competition Strategy with Bankroll Management

The competitive thrill of climbing a tournament leaderboard can sometimes tempt players into abandoning sound bankroll principles. Over-wagering to catch a rival on the standings exposes your balance to catastrophic variance.

Maintaining strict unit sizing remains essential, even when competing in short-duration sprint tournaments. Your single-hand wager should never exceed 1% to 2% of your overall active playing capital.

Disciplined unit sizing protects your bankroll during cold dealer shoes while leaving sufficient capital to execute vital split and double-down opportunities. Proper execution preserves your capital long enough for strategic play to yield positive leaderboard points naturally.

  1. Set Strict Stop-Loss Limits: Establish clear session boundaries and walk away if a cold streak impacts your base bankroll.

  2. Monitor Opponent Velocity: Track competitor point accumulation rates to identify low-density playing windows.

  3. Avoid Unnecessary Side Bets: Skip optional side wagers like Perfect Pairs unless they directly advance tournament scoring metrics.

  4. Time Your Sprint Sessions: Play during off-peak hours when fewer active competitors are competing at the tables.

Treating leaderboard events as a secondary bonus rather than a primary goal protects your financial integrity. Maintaining tight basic strategy ensures that your underlying gameplay remains profitable regardless of tournament outcomes.

Selecting Fast Payment Rails for Immediate Withdrawals

Once you convert tournament success into spendable cash, selecting the proper withdrawal gateway dictates how fast your funds arrive. Modern platforms support a diverse array of rapid payment technologies designed for verified players.

Combining pre-verified account status with high-speed payment rails ensures that your winning sessions end with instant payouts. Compare the processing metrics of common withdrawal options below:

  • E-Wallets (Skrill/Neteller/PayPal): Delivers near-instant cashouts once internal financial approvals finish.

  • Cryptocurrency (USDT/BTC/LTC): Provides rapid, decentralized transfers with low transaction overhead and complete privacy.

  • Instant Open Banking (Trustly/Interac): Connects directly to regional bank accounts for secure same-day deposits.

  • Traditional Bank Wires: Requires three to five business days due to intermediary clearing network schedules.

Utilizing digital payment channels eliminates standard banking holds and transfer delays. Furthermore, e-wallets and crypto gateways maintain high transaction limits, making them ideal for high-volume table strategists.
